:root{--color-brand-1: #00AEFF;--color-green: #0ECD63;--color-dark-green: #0CB859;--color-light-green: #56DC91;--color-dark-blue: var(--color-brand-1)}@keyframes rotate-counter{from{transform:rotate(0deg)}to{transform:rotate(-360deg)}}.sub-nav-linked-section{padding-top:1.5rem;margin-top:-1.5rem}@media (min-width: 0) and (max-width: 768px){.sub-nav-linked-section{padding-top:0;margin-top:0}}#landlord-resources-sub-nav{max-width:75rem}#landlord-resources-sub-nav .mortgage-affiliates-secondary-nav-link{color:#34414D}@media (min-width: 0) and (max-width: 480px){#landlord-resources-sub-nav .mortgage-affiliates-secondary-nav-link{margin-right:2rem}}.two-resources-per-row .landlord-resource-redesign{flex:0 48%}.three-resources-per-row .landlord-resource-redesign{flex:0 32%}.landlord-resources-redesign-container{display:flex;flex-wrap:wrap;justify-content:space-between}.landlord-resources-redesign-container .landlord-resource-redesign{min-width:380px;min-height:270px;box-sizing:border-box;background:#FFFFFF;padding:1.5rem;text-align:left;box-shadow:0px 2px 4px 0px rgba(0,0,0,0.5);border-radius:2px;margin-bottom:1.5rem;display:flex;flex-direction:column;justify-content:space-between}.landlord-resources-redesign-container .landlord-resource-redesign:hover{cursor:pointer}@media (min-width: 768px) and (max-width: 1024px){.landlord-resources-redesign-container .landlord-resource-redesign{min-width:360px;flex:0 48.5%}}@media (min-width: 320px) and (max-width: 767px){.landlord-resources-redesign-container .landlord-resource-redesign{min-width:340px;flex:0 100%}}@media (min-width: 0) and (max-width: 320px){.landlord-resources-redesign-container .landlord-resource-redesign{min-width:285px;flex:0 100%}}.landlord-resources-redesign-container .landlord-resource-redesign .new-featured-badge-container{display:flex;justify-content:center;margin-top:-0.7rem}.landlord-resources-redesign-container .landlord-resource-redesign .new-featured-badge-container .featured-badge{background:#DFB119;color:#FFFFFF;font-weight:600;font-size:0.875rem;border-radius:10px;width:180px;height:22px}.landlord-resources-redesign-container .landlord-resource-redesign .new-featured-badge-container .featured-badge img{margin:4px 0 0 5px}.landlord-resources-redesign-container .landlord-resource-card-link{color:#34414D}.landlord-resources-redesign-container .landlord-resources-phantom-card{width:24rem;height:0}.landlord-resources-redesign-container .featured{border:1px solid #DFB119}.landlord-resources-redesign-container .new-featured{border:3px solid #DFB119;flex:1 100%;padding-top:0px}.landlord-resources-redesign-container .landlord-resource-logo{max-height:4rem;margin-top:2rem;margin-bottom:1rem;height:50px;width:auto;max-width:100%}@media (min-width: 320px) and (max-width: 1024px){.landlord-resources-redesign-container .landlord-resource-logo{height:42px}}@media (min-width: 0) and (max-width: 319px){.landlord-resources-redesign-container .landlord-resource-logo{height:30px}}.landlord-resources-redesign-container .landlord-resource-title{font-size:1.125rem;font-weight:600;margin:0}.landlord-resources-redesign-container .landlord-resource-description{position:relative;font-size:1rem;line-height:22px;max-height:calc(22px * 6);overflow:hidden;margin-bottom:0.75rem}.landlord-resources-redesign-container .landlord-resource-description::before{position:absolute;content:"...";bottom:0;right:0}.landlord-resources-redesign-container .landlord-resource-description::after{content:"";position:absolute;right:0;width:1rem;height:22px;background:white}.landlord-resources-redesign-container .landlord-resource-featured-badge{position:absolute;display:inline-block;background:#DFB119;color:#FFFFFF;font-weight:600;font-size:0.875rem;padding:0 0.5rem;border-radius:2px;margin-bottom:1rem;line-height:1.2}.landlord-resources-redesign-container .landlord-resource-services-container{display:inline-block}.landlord-resources-redesign-container .landlord-resource-services-label{font-weight:600;color:var(--color-dark-green)}.landlord-resources-redesign-container .landlord-resource-service{display:inline-block;line-height:19px;margin-right:0.25rem}.landlord-resources-redesign-container .landlord-resource-learn-more-container{margin-top:1rem}.landlord-resources-redesign-container .landlord-resource-learn-more{font-weight:600;font-size:1rem}.landlord-resources-property-management{padding-top:3rem;margin-bottom:4rem}@media (min-width: 0) and (max-width: 767px){.landlord-resources-property-management{padding:2rem 1rem 0;margin-bottom:3rem}}.landlord-resources-property-management-header{font-size:1.8rem;font-weight:800;margin-bottom:0}@media (min-width: 768px) and (max-width: 1024px){.landlord-resources-property-management-header{font-size:1.875rem}}@media (min-width: 0) and (max-width: 767px){.landlord-resources-property-management-header{font-size:1.5rem}}.landlord-resources-books{margin-bottom:4rem}@media (min-width: 0) and (max-width: 767px){.landlord-resources-books{padding:0 1rem;margin-bottom:3rem}}.landlord-resources-books-subheader{font-size:1.5rem;font-weight:800;line-height:33px;margin-bottom:2.5rem;text-transform:uppercase}@media (min-width: 0) and (max-width: 767px){.landlord-resources-books-subheader{font-size:1.125rem;line-height:24px}}.landlord-resources-books-container{border-bottom:1px solid #99A0A6;display:flex;padding-bottom:4rem}@media (min-width: 0) and (max-width: 768px){.landlord-resources-books-container{flex-wrap:wrap;padding-bottom:3rem}}.landlord-resources-book-container{flex:0 25%;display:flex;flex-direction:column;color:#34414D}.landlord-resources-book-container:not(:last-of-type){margin-right:1rem}@media (min-width: 480px) and (max-width: 768px){.landlord-resources-book-container{flex:0 48%}.landlord-resources-book-container:nth-of-type(2n+2){margin-right:0}}@media (min-width: 0) and (max-width: 480px){.landlord-resources-book-container{flex:0 100%;flex-direction:row;margin-bottom:2rem}.landlord-resources-book-container:nth-of-type(n){margin-right:0}}.landlord-resources-book-cover-container{margin-bottom:1rem}@media (min-width: 0) and (max-width: 480px){.landlord-resources-book-cover-container{margin-bottom:0}}.landlord-resources-book-cover{max-height:216px;box-shadow:0 2px 4px 0 rgba(0,0,0,0.5)}@media (min-width: 0) and (max-width: 480px){.landlord-resources-book-cover{max-height:140px}}@media (min-width: 1025px){.landlord-resources-book-info-container{max-width:72%}}@media (min-width: 480px) and (max-width: 768px){.landlord-resources-book-info-container{max-width:72%}}@media (min-width: 0) and (max-width: 480px){.landlord-resources-book-info-container{display:flex;flex-direction:column;justify-content:center;margin-left:0.75rem}}.landlord-resources-book-title{font-size:1.125rem;font-weight:600;line-height:24px;margin-bottom:0}@media (min-width: 0) and (max-width: 480px){.landlord-resources-book-title{font-size:1rem;line-height:22px}}.landlord-resource-book-author{font-size:1.125rem;line-height:24px}@media (min-width: 0) and (max-width: 480px){.landlord-resource-book-author{font-size:1rem;line-height:22px}}.landlord-resources-lease-agreements{background-image:url(//bpimg.biggerpockets.com/assets/tools/landlord_resources/states_background-30ba252d74c4d2f577af8ceba0e0cbefe33ebe6649c5b7e2a52981f617d5cdfc.avif);background-size:contain;background-repeat:no-repeat;background-position:0 8rem;padding:3rem 0 3.5rem 0}@media (min-width: 480px) and (max-width: 768px){.landlord-resources-lease-agreements{height:650px}}@media (min-width: 0) and (max-width: 768px){.landlord-resources-lease-agreements{background-image:none;height:auto;padding-bottom:3.5rem}}@media (min-width: 0) and (max-width: 480px){.landlord-resources-lease-agreements{margin-bottom:0}}.landlord-resources-lease-agreements-subheader{font-size:1.5rem;font-weight:800;line-height:33px;margin-bottom:2.5rem;text-transform:uppercase}@media (min-width: 0) and (max-width: 480px){.landlord-resources-lease-agreements-subheader{font-size:1.125rem;line-height:24px}}.landlord-resources-lease-agreements-state-container{height:520px;display:flex;flex-direction:column;flex-wrap:wrap}@media (min-width: 0) and (max-width: 768px){.landlord-resources-lease-agreements-state-container{height:1040px}}.landlord-resources-state{font-size:1rem;font-weight:600;line-height:40px}.landlord-resources-pro-member-discounts{margin-bottom:4rem}@media (min-width: 0) and (max-width: 767px){.landlord-resources-pro-member-discounts{padding:0 1rem;margin-bottom:3rem}}.landlord-resources-pro-member-discounts-subheader{font-size:1.5rem;font-weight:800;line-height:33px;margin-bottom:2.5rem;text-transform:uppercase}@media (min-width: 0) and (max-width: 480px){.landlord-resources-pro-member-discounts-subheader{font-size:1.125rem;line-height:24px}}.landlord-resources-pro-member-discount-logos .slick-list{margin:0 3rem}.landlord-resources-pro-member-discount-logos .slick-prev{left:-1rem;z-index:50;bottom:50%}.landlord-resources-pro-member-discount-logos .slick-prev:before{background:url(//bpimg.biggerpockets.com/assets/tools/landlord_resources/arrow_right-e64c9ca9224fc5d79d06e0625c7bfff6fc086a0fd167646a78e2284f57be0234.png) no-repeat;background-size:contain;height:45px;width:45px}.landlord-resources-pro-member-discount-logos .slick-next{left:calc(100% - 45px);bottom:50%}.landlord-resources-pro-member-discount-logos .slick-next:before{background:url(//bpimg.biggerpockets.com/assets/tools/landlord_resources/arrow_right-e64c9ca9224fc5d79d06e0625c7bfff6fc086a0fd167646a78e2284f57be0234.png) no-repeat;background-size:contain;height:45px;width:45px}.landlord-resources-pro-member-discount-logo-container{width:100%;text-align:center}.landlord-resources-pro-member-discount-logo{display:inline-block !important;max-height:90px;max-width:240px}@media (min-width: 480px) and (max-width: 1024px){.landlord-resources-pro-member-discount-logo{max-height:50px;max-width:200px}}@media (min-width: 0) and (max-width: 479px){.landlord-resources-pro-member-discount-logo{max-height:40px;max-width:160px}}.landlord-resources-faqs-header{font-size:1.8rem;font-weight:800}@media (min-width: 768px) and (max-width: 1024px){.landlord-resources-faqs-header{font-size:1.875rem}}@media (min-width: 0) and (max-width: 480px){.landlord-resources-faqs-header{font-size:1.5rem}}.landlord-resources-faqs{margin-bottom:4rem}@media (min-width: 480px) and (max-width: 768px){.landlord-resources-faqs{margin-bottom:3rem}}.landlord-resources-faqs .landlord-resources-header-container{margin-bottom:0}.landlord-resources-faqs .faq-wrapper{margin-bottom:0}.landlord-resources-faqs .faq{padding:1.75rem 0;border:none;border-bottom:1px solid #C2C6C9}@media (min-width: 0) and (max-width: 480px){.landlord-resources-faqs .faq{padding:1.5rem 0}}.landlord-resources-faqs .faq .expand-icon{color:#999999}.landlord-resources-faqs .faq .collapse-icon{color:#999999}.landlord-resources-faqs .faq .icon{height:27px;width:27px}.landlord-resources-faqs .faq.open .faq-answer{font-size:1rem}.landlord-resources-faqs .faq-question{font-size:1.25rem;line-height:27px;font-weight:600}@media (min-width: 0) and (max-width: 480px){.landlord-resources-faqs .faq-question{padding:0;font-size:1rem;line-height:20px}}.landlord-resources-faqs .faq-answer{margin-right:4rem}.landlord-resources-content-container{max-width:78rem;margin:0 auto}@media (min-width: 0) and (max-width: 767px){.landlord-resources-content-container{padding:2rem 0}}.landlord-resources-parent-container{max-width:75rem}.landlord-resources-parent-container .mortgage-affiliates-header{padding-top:20px;line-height:52px}@media (min-width: 480px) and (max-width: 768px){.landlord-resources-parent-container .mortgage-affiliates-header{line-height:2.8125rem}}@media (min-width: 0) and (max-width: 480px){.landlord-resources-parent-container .mortgage-affiliates-header{line-height:2.375rem}}.landlord-resources-parent-container .landlord-resources-header-text{font-size:2.125rem}@media (min-width: 0) and (max-width: 480px){.landlord-resources-parent-container .landlord-resources-header-text{font-size:1.625rem}}.landlord-resources-header{background-image:url(//bpimg.biggerpockets.com/assets/tools/landlord_resources/hero-c03a39add272760995f44a2f37aa946899c7c6444ae5d8f10cb536dd8e3d9e57.jpg);background-size:cover;background-repeat:no-repeat;background-position:center;padding:2rem;height:208px;display:flex;justify-content:center;align-items:center}@media (min-width: 0) and (max-width: 768px){.landlord-resources-header{padding:2rem 0}}@media (min-width: 0) and (max-width: 480px){.landlord-resources-header{background-position:60% 0}}.landlord-resources-header .mortgage-affiliate-services-header-text{font-weight:800}.landlord-resources-header-container{max-width:78rem;margin:0 auto 2rem;padding:2rem 0 0}@media (min-width: 480px) and (max-width: 768px){.landlord-resources-header-container{padding:1.5rem 0 0}}@media (min-width: 0) and (max-width: 480px){.landlord-resources-header-container{padding:0}}.landlord-resources-header-text{font-size:1.8rem;font-weight:800;text-align:left;margin-bottom:0}@media (min-width: 768px) and (max-width: 1024px){.landlord-resources-header-text{font-size:1.875rem}}@media (min-width: 0) and (max-width: 767px){.landlord-resources-header-text{padding:0;width:100%;font-size:1.5rem}}
